Web Desk: Millions’ worth, 375 kilograms of crystal methamphetamine seized from a vehicle traveling on the M-8 highway in Balochistan, officials said, marking one of the latest major drug busts in the country’s ongoing crackdown on narcotics trafficking.

The operation took place at 12:01 a.m. on Feb. 26 after personnel from 132 Wing received intelligence from a field source, officials said. Acting on the tip-off, security forces stopped a suspicious Mazda truck, bearing registration number TKN-101, en route from Panjgur to Turbat.

Upon conducting a detailed search of the vehicle, authorities recovered 375 kg of methamphetamine, commonly known as “ICE.” Officials estimated the value of the seized drugs at approximately 187.5 million Pakistani rupees ($670,000).
